Is The Cove Safe?

Yes — this neighborhood is very safe. The Cove in Atlanta, GA has a safety grade of A. The overall crime index is 93, which is 7% below the national average of 100.

Compared to the Atlanta average (crime index 122), The Cove is 29% lower in overall crime.

Looking at specific crime types, robbery is the most elevated concern (index: 175, 75% above average), while burglary is the lowest risk (index: 78). Violent crime is a particular area of concern relative to property crime in this neighborhood.
